Publisher's Summary
In Our Revolution: A Future to Believe In, Vermont Senator Bernie Sanders outlines his career and political ideals. The book includes an autobiographical sketch of his early life, a discussion of his 2016 campaign for the Democratic presidential nomination, and a summary of his views on important national issues. Sanders believes that the wealthy control government institutions and the national media to their own advantage, and that a popular electoral revolution is needed to rein in corruption and give working people jobs, opportunities, and a decent standard of living including equitable access to quality health care and education.
Sanders was born in Brooklyn, New York, to working-class parents. His older brother Larry taught him a love of reading. Sanders was the first one in his family to attend an elite university when he went to the University of Chicago.
